A rose by any other name: You read it here first — the Divine Miss M (to the uninitiated, that’s renowned songbird and environmentalist Bette Midler) is confirmed to headline the Jan. 31 Raising Hope gala, the sixth biennial fundraiser for the Comprehensive Cancer Center at UCSF.

Gary and Nanci Fredkin and Cathy and Mike Podell will once again serve as gala co-chairs for this most successful philanthropic event, which has raised almost $17 million since its inception in 1996. Event designer Stanlee Gatti will (once again) dream up the look and feel of the party when he works his magic on a brand-new space: the Mission Bay campus of UCSF.
